1. Sustainable Solutions for the Future

In a world grappling with climate change and resource scarcity, sustainability is not just a trend—it’s a necessity. Engineers are spearheading the development of clean energy options like solar panels, wind turbines, and even biofuels. Their innovative designs are paving the way towards a greener future.

The concept of renewable energy sources isn’t simply theoretical; it’s being implemented in real-world situations. Take, for instance, the rise of electric car models—a testament to engineers’ dedication to creating eco-friendly transportation options.

2. Transforming Healthcare and Improving Lives

The impact of engineering on healthcare is truly transformative. From developing life-saving medical devices like artificial limbs to designing advanced surgical robots, engineers are directly influencing the well-being of countless people.

Take, for instance, the progress made in personalized medicine. Engineers play a crucial role in developing tailored treatment plans based on individual genetic profiles, paving the way for more precise and effective healthcare solutions.
